FIGURE 9.6. Damping of oscillations of
a weathervane computed by finite-span, quasistatic, and
two-dimensional theories. N1/2, the number of cycles to
damp to half amplitude, is plotted as; function of
, where
is frequency
in radians per second, b is span of weather vane, and v is velocity.
Frequency varied by changing the inertia.
